Russian-English dictionary »

симферополь meaning in English

RussianEnglish
Симферополь proper noun
{m}

Simferopol(city)
proper noun
[UK: ˌsɪmfəˈrɔːp(ə)l] [US: ˌsɪmfəˈrɔːp(ə)l]